Illicit Christmas booze seized in London

Published date 2013-12-19 14:59
Around 60,000 litres of smuggled vodka and beer have been seized from two industrial units in Edmonton, north London, during a pre-Christmas raid by HM Revenue and Customs (HMRC).

Leave a Reply

Your email address will not be published. Required fields are marked *